DataTables

צילום מסך תוכנה:
DataTables
פרטי תוכנה:
גרסה: 1.11.3 מעודכן
טען תאריך: 1 Oct 15
מפתחים: Allan Jardine
רשיון: ללא תשלום
פופולריות: 527
גודל: 1875 Kb

Rating: 3.0/5 (Total Votes: 1)

התוסף מושלם להצגת רשתות נתונים, ערכות נתונים והצגת סטים מאורגנים גדולים של נתונים בדף אינטרנט

מה חדש בהודעה זו:.

  • API החדש
  • מקרה סימון גמלים
  • סגנונות חדשים
  • Built-in שיפורי עימוד
  • HTML 5 הדינאמי * תמיכת תכונה
  • משופרים מובנים מיון וזיהוי סוג
  • קל יותר טיפול אייאקס
  • מימין לשמאל תמיכת פריסה

מה חדש בגרסה 1.10.7:

    • API החדש
    • מקרה סימון גמלים
    • סגנונות חדשים
    • Built-in שיפורי עימוד
    • HTML 5 הדינאמי * תמיכת תכונה
    • משופרים מובנים מיון וזיהוי סוג
    • קל יותר טיפול אייאקס
    • מימין לשמאל תמיכת פריסה

    מה חדש בגרסת 1.10.5 / 1.10.6-dev:

  • API החדש
    • מקרה סימון גמלים
    • סגנונות חדשים
    • Built-in שיפורי עימוד
    • HTML 5 הדינאמי * תמיכת תכונה
    • משופרים מובנים מיון וזיהוי סוג
    • קל יותר טיפול אייאקס
    • מימין לשמאל תמיכת פריסה
    • מה חדש בגרסת 1.9.3

    :.

    • ​​CSS נפל הוסר מthemeroller קובץ >
    • שגיאות הקלדה קבועה בדוגמאות / API / multi_filter_select.html.

    • קווי CSS כפולים
    • הוסר.
    • בדיקת יחידה המעודכנת לmData שם השינוי מmDataProp. שים לב שמספר הבדיקות כדי לבדוק את compability לאחור של mDataProp.
    • שימוש הוסר של $ .browser מאז זה הוצא משימוש בjQuery 1.8 ויוסר לחלוטין בjQuery 1.9.
    • דוגמאות עדכון.

    מה חדש בגרסת 1.9.2:

    • תיקונים:

    • נוסף jqXHR חיסכון לדוגמא fnServerData
    • שגיאות תחביר JSDoc שנאספו על-ידי JSDoc Toolkit
    • API: שיטת $, בעת שימוש עם טיוח נדחה, כאשר כל השורות לא היו שניתנו, תוצאות בjQuery מנסות לבצע בורר על 'בטל' שזורק שגיאה. עכשיו לבדוק TR שנוצר לפני הוספתו למערך לעבור לjQuery
    • השתמש $ וfnUpdate בדוגמא טור מדד
    • fnDeleteRow עלול לגרום לדף לרדת בחזרה על ידי אחד
    • שיחות fnClose בfnPreDrawCallback תגרום שגיאה
    • אפשר כיתות כותרת עליונה והתחתונות מותאמות אישית JUI
    • דוגמא fnStateLoad יש פרמטר חילוף (אם כי לא ברשימת הפרמטרים).

    מה חדש בגרסת 1.9.1:

    • עדכון:--webkit0overflow גלילה: מגע בכל קבצי dataTables_scrollBody CSS
    • DataTables - 1.9.1 שחרור: -)
    • בדיקות יחידה תקן: סוכנים, הוא לשנות כדי לאפשר פקודות מאקרו מידע בכל אחד ממייתרי הבדיקות היחידה צריכים לעדכן כדי לשקף את זה
    • בדיקה יחידה תקן: מספר הטעויות בבדיקה זו
    • חדש: & quot; להרוס & quot; אירוע - כאשר השולחן נהרס להרוס אירוע כעת מופעל. זה דומה מאוד לאופן שבי aoDestroyCallback עבד לפני, אבל זה מביא את היישום לתוך קו עם הקריאה החוזרת החדשה / אירועים mechanisim משמשים בDataTable
    • עדכון: עדכון הטקסט לשתי דוגמאות jEditable
    • חדשה: טור אפשרות & quot; sCellType & quot; - מאפשר לך ליצור תאי TD (ברירת מחדל) או TH לטור. שימושי ליצירת כותרות שורה בtbody.
    • חדש: שיטת API סטטי - fnVersionCheck זהה לבדיקת הגרסה שכבר זמין כשיטת למשל, אבל כאן זמין כשיטת API סטטי המצורפת ל.fn.dataTable $
    • חדש: שיטת API סטטי - fnIsDataTable - לבדוק אם צומת שולחן היא
    • DataTable או לא
    • חדש: שיטת API סטטי - fnTables - לקבל DataTables שיוזם על השולחן (אופציונלי להגביל רק השולחנות הגלויים)
    • תיקון: גובה Scrollbody בIE7- - שימוש offsetHeight באופן עקבי - 9424
    • API - תיקון: הפרמטר לfnDraw היה הפוך בטעות ב1.9.0 השחרור - 7,825
    • תיקון פיתוח: נענו def משתנה בשינוי _fnLanguageCompat האחרון
    • Docs - תיקון: פרמטר oSettings הצג בדוגמא fnDrawCallback - 9067
    • Docs - תיקון: הקלדה
    • Docs - תיקון: תיעוד fnSort מעודכן כדי לציין מיון טור - 9094
    • תקן: פונקציות afnSortData לא מבוצעות עם ההיקף של מופע DataTables

    מה חדש בגרסת 1.9.0:

    • יש DataTables 1.9 הרבה API משופר להתאמה אישית מדינה , אבל זה נועד להסיר את הפרמטרים הישנים fnStateLoadCallback וfnStateSaveCallback.

    מה חדש בגרסת 1.8.2:

    • תיקון: תיקון תאימות מבחן יחידה לIE7
    • חדש: אם מקור הנתונים נמצא להיות פונקציה, אז הפונקציה מבוצעת והתמורה משמשת לתצוגה הסלולרי (+ מיון, סינון וכו '). זה שימושי לשילוב עם knockout.js וbackbone.js וכו '.
    • חדש: כל דוגמאות שמראות בקשות אייאקס עכשיו להראות את תגובת JSON מהשרת (מסומן להיות עיצוב JSON readiable) והתגובות הראו יעדכנו עם כל בקשה נוספת. הרעיון הוא להפוך את העיצוב שDataTables מצפה / יכול להתמודד עם יותר ברור
    • תיקון פיתוח: האירועים מותאמים אישית החדשים תמיד יעברו DataTables הגדרות אובייקט כפרמטר הראשון
    • עדכון לjQuery האחרון - 1.6.3

    מה חדש בגרסת 1.8.1:

    • תיקון פיתוח: fnDestry לא תגיש מקורי עם כראוי בשל טעות במוקדם להתחייב - נטל על ידי בדיקות יחידה
    • תקן: יישור שורה עם x-גלילת נכים והשולחן הקטן מדי כדי להסיק באופן מלא. בעבר היה DataTables לפלוט שגיאה על העמודות לא יישור במקרה זה, ולאחר מכן אנסה כמיטב היכולת לצייר את השולחן, אבל זה היה בסופו של מחפש די רע. התיקון הוא לא לאפשר לשולחן לצייר קטן יותר ממה שהוא אולי יכול להיות כאשר x-גלילת מושבת. אפקטים זה שולחנות באופן דינמי לשנות את גודל - 5232
    • עדכון: לאובייקטים, לשקול mDataProp שנשלח מDataTables למיון וסינון כדי לקבל את הסדר הנכון של השורות. זה שימושי לColReorder ואופן כללי יותר היא מגדילה את flexability של כל השולחן
    • חדש: שלח mDataProp לשרת לעיבוד בצד השרת. זה מאוד simialr לפרמטר sNames, אבל convient יותר כאשר כבר משתמש mDataProp
    • עדכון: עדכון לjQuery האחרון - 1.6.1

    • יש לי עמודות שsortable אך מוסתר אירועים מצורפים אליהם למיון, אך מטפל באירועים זה לא יוסר כאשר העמודה נעשתה גלויה שוב לfnDestroy:
    • תקן. פשוט צריך לשנות את הסדר של איך להרוס נעשה - כלומר להסיר אירועים רק לאחר העמודות נעשות גלויות, לא לפני - 5497
    • תקן: כאשר ביטויים מורכבים בנויים עם aoColumnDefs, וכתוצאה מכך היכולת לטור שהפכו & quot; לסירוגין & quot; במהלך אתחול, זה יביא לשיעורי העמודה אולי לא להיות נכון למיון - 5472 - כבוד לrups לתיקון זה
    • החדש: תכונות accessability - האורך משתנה שליטה ובקרת סינון כעת עטופים ב& # x3c; x3e תווית & #; תגים (יחסים מפורשים לאלמנטי הקלט שלהם) כדי לסייע accessability. אתה יכול לראות את זה באופן מיידי, פשוט על ידי לחיצה על & quot; החיפוש: & quot; טקסט עכשיו -. זה יתמקד הקלט של תיבת הטקסט, ואילו עבור קוראי מסך זה ייתן את טקסט התווית מהתווית
    • חדש: מחרוזת שפת קלט הסינון (oLanguage.sSearch) עכשיו יש את & quot; מאקרו & quot; _INPUT_ בזה כדי לאפשר לאלמנט הקלט להיות ממוקם בכל מקום במחרוזת. לדוגמא, אם אתה נתן & quot; & quot ;: sSearch & quot; Data_INPUT_Tables & quot; הפלט עבור המסנן יהיה & quot; נתונים & # x3c; הקלט ... / & # x3e; שולחנות & quot ;. זה הוא אופציונאלי -. אם _INPUT_ לא ניתן, אז כמו קודם רצון יהיה טקטיקה אלמנט הקלט לסוף (או ברירת מחדל) מחרוזת טקסט נתון
    • תקן: פירוש היכולת להשתמש במבני נתונים מורכבים ב1.8 שמערכים שהם עברו לfnUpdate לא צריכים להיות באותו האורך כמו מספר העמודות בטבלה בהחלט - ולכן האזהרה שניתנה אם אתה עושה את זה לא נכון ... לא חלו שינויי קוד אחרים נחוצים - פשוט אין צורך ליצור את האזהרה! בדיקה יחידה שנוספה - 5396
    • דוגמאות לתקן: יש שולחן פרטי עמודה אחת נוספת בזה בהתחלה, כך זה צריכה להילקח בחשבון בעת ​​מיון - 5422
    • תקן: רוחב השולחן אינו מוגדר כאשר הרוחב אוטומטי מושבתים ולכן אנחנו לא צריכים להגדיר את זה כשהורס את השולחן - 5220
    • DataTables התחל פיתוח 1.8.1
    • תיקון: כמה שגיאות הקלדה בדוגמאות

    מה חדש בגרסת 1.7.5:

    • קבוע: fnInitComplete לא היה הדבר האחרון להיות להורג בעת שימוש במקור DOM. ייתכן שאתה יכול להגדיר sAjaxSource בfnInitComplete אשר היו אז תפעיל DataTables לעשות שיחת אייאקס באופן שגוי.

    • עדכון: אמינות של בדיקות יחידה בדפדפנים שאינם WebKit
    • קבוע: fnDrawCallback היה למעשה הראשון של פונקציות התיקו callback שנקראה (שיחות הטלפון הפנימיות נקראו מאוחר יותר). זה לא היה נכון, ואנחנו עכשיו לולאה על המערך כדי לקבל את הסדר שאנחנו רוצים. בשלב מסוים בעתיד זה עלול להידרש לי הזמנה אם אלה לצייר שיחות הטלפון הפכו interdependant.
    • ביצועים: כתב Re יישום המיון, אז זה לא להשתמש גם eval () של .inArray $ (). inArray נמצא להיות השפעה שלילית חמורה על IE שסופרת את הפעילות לתת "התסריט פועל לאט" הודעת שגיאה - implemention החדש משתמש ערך / מיפוי הפוך מפתח כדי להפוך את להסתכל למעלה במהירות וretreival פרמטר אובייקט יחיד. יתר על כן, עשיתי קצת עבודת שלמות אופטימיזציה ותכונה בגרסה הלא-הערכה של המיון (בעבר שיטת מיון AIR) ואני מצאתי את זה כדי להיות טוב לפחות כמו (מהיר יותר במקרים מסוימים) מאשר eval הישן סוג (), אז זה עכשיו ברירת המחדל וDataTables שיטת מיון רק מספק - 2,922
    • מיזוג 'אדון' סניף של github.com:DataTables/DataTables
    • עדכון: fnAdjustColumnSizing כאשר נקראים עם 'שקר' כפרמטר הראשון (ויחידה) כעת להחיל את גדלי עמודה מחושבים לשולחן בעת ​​הגלילה נמצאת בשימוש. זה מאפשר עדכון שאינו אייאקס להתרחש אם באמצעות עיבוד בצד השרת. תודה לחתול וייסמן לתיקון זה.
    • עדכון: fnAdjustColumnSizing כאשר נקראים עם 'שקר' כפרמטר הראשון (ויחידה) כעת להחיל את גדלי עמודה מחושבים לשולחן בעת ​​הגלילה נמצאת בשימוש. זה מאפשר עדכון-אייאקס לא להתרחש אם באמצעות עיבוד בצד השרת.
    • קבוע: ההתנהגות לכותרות מורכבות השתנתה מעט לכותרות מורכבות שברק הראשון של אלמנטי TH אינם ייחודיים יהיה לחץ כדי למיין-מסוגל. עדכון בדיקה יחידה הנחוץ כמו זה התנהגות שונה מלפני כאשר כל האלמנטים השייכים לטור היו לחצו כדי למיין.
    • עדכון - עכשיו באמצעות jQuery 1.4.4 כעותק של jQuery נכלל בחלוקה DataTables. עובר את כל הבדיקות היחידה
    • קבוע: כאשר משתמש בעיבוד בצד שרת ושנקרא fnDestroy, לא עושה XHR אחר לשרת כלא ישמשו נתונים - 3375
    • תקן: כראוי להוסיף sClass לאלמנטי TH בכותרת
    • חדש: הוספת אפשרות bScrollAutoCss (ברירת מחדל אמיתית). זה מאפשר לך לשלוט בסגנונות הגלילה עם CSS, שבו בדרך כלל כDataTables יהיה להגדיר (ולעקוף) הסגנונות עצמו. זה שימושי לאם אתה רוצה להיות פס גלילה מראה בכל העת (בדרך כלל האוטומטי).
    • קבועים: הסר עיצוב נועז בעת שימוש JUI כמו שזה נראה מחוץ למקום בבקרה השולחן
    • חדש: אפשרויות חשיפת הטור בDataTables (bVisible וfnSetColumnVis) עכשיו לקחת בחשבון יותר משורה אחת בTHEAD וTFOOT. שים לב שcolspan וrowspan לא נתמך בעת שימוש באפשרויות חשיפת טור בכותרת העליונה והתחתונה, וסביר מאוד להיות השפעות שהם בכלל לא רצויים. ככזה יש תנאים על שימוש זה (שים לב שאם יש לך רק שורה אחת בכותרת העליונה / התחתונה, אז זה אין השפעה), במיוחד את מספר התאים בכותרת העליון / התחתונה הרבה יהיה שווה לעמודים * שורות (ב כל אחד). DataTables הדרך זו בצורה מדויקת יכול להוסיף ולהסיר תאים בהתאם לצורך. התאים יכולים להיות אלמנטים או TH או TD, אבל DataTables עדיין דורש אלמנט TH לפחות אחד עבור כל עמודה.
    • עדכון: בעבר, כאשר מספר התאים התגלו כייחודיים לעמודה האחרונה תינתן עדיפות (כלומר מיון מטפל באירועים וכו '). זה כבר לא המקרה והראשון יהיה בראש סדר עדיפויות.
    • קבוע: הסר את הפרמטר "sNames 'שהוצג לעיבוד בצד השרת ב1.7.4. הפרמטר "sColumns 'למעשה מבצע בדיוק משימה זו כבר. DOH. גם לעדכן את PHP הדוגמא לקחת את זה בחשבון - 3218

    דרישות :

    • לאפשר Javascript בצד הלקוח
    • jQuery

  • צילומי מסך

    datatables_1_77689.png

    תוכנה דומה

    simpleEqualize
    simpleEqualize

    13 Apr 15

    jLoader
    jLoader

    5 Jun 15

    Matrix.js
    Matrix.js

    13 May 15

    תגובות ל DataTables

    תגובות לא נמצא
    להוסיף הערה
    הפעל את התמונות!